As United Methodists, we are part of a global and spiritual connection. We are connected with other United Methodist congregations in our area known as the Cheaha District, which is in turn connected with every other United Methodist congregation in North Alabama under the North Alabama Conference of the United Methodist Church. Our Conference under the the spiritual leadership of Bishop Debra Wallace-Padgett, is connected to United Methodism nationally and globally and continues to be a spiritual movement that makes disciples of Jesus Christ for the transformation of the world. From UMC.org:
The United Methodist Church is an 12.5-million-strong global church that opens hearts, opens minds and open doors through active engagement with our world. John Wesley and the early Methodists placed primary emphasis on Christian living, on putting faith and love into action. This emphasis on what Wesley referred to as "practical divinity" has continued to be a hallmark of United Methodism today

How are you giving thanks today?

"Now Thank We All Our God", number 102 in The United Methodist Hymnal, invites us to consider what we have received from God, and how we might proclaim our gratitude. Surprisingly, the words for the hymn were written amidst struggle and want, as Martin Rinckart and his family were refugees during the Thirty Years' War (1618-1648).

🎶"Now thank we all our God,
with heart and hands and voices,
who wondrous things has done,
in whom this world rejoices;
who from our mothers’ arms
has blessed us on our way
with countless gifts of love,
and still is ours today." 🎹
